    Embrace the supernaturally spine-chilling spirit with Halloween comics!

    Every Monday throughout the month of October, you can visit Marvel.com for a new week’s worth of creepy comics to read! Individually selected by Earth’s Mightiest Show hosts Lorraine Cink and Langston Belton, these issues will feature the greatest, most haunting horror stories from across Marvel history.

    We begin the 31 Days of Halloween with seven spellbinding stories to read from today, October 8, through October 15. Readers, beware!
